Why IELTS Preparation is Crucial
Preparing for the IELTS exam is important for a number of reasons:
- Understanding the Test Format: The IELTS makes up four modules: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. Acquainting oneself with the format enhances test performance.
- Targeted Practice: With the right products, candidates can concentrate on their weak areas and improve their overall ratings.
- Time Management: Regular practice assists candidates manage their time efficiently during the real test.
- Fluency and Confidence: Engaging with practice material aids in establishing fluency and builds self-confidence, which is crucial for the Speaking module.

Reliable Study Strategies
When you have actually determined the ideal resources, implementing efficient study methods is essential to maximizing your preparation. Here are some recommended strategies for IELTS candidates in Uzbekistan:
1. Create a Study Schedule

2. Focus on Weak Areas
Determine which modules or question types are most tough. If, for example, the Listening section shows tough, devote extra time to listening exercises, such as podcasts or IELTS listening practice tests.
3. Utilize Authentic Materials
Engaging with genuine materials assists to acquaint oneself with the language used in scholastic settings. Reading papers, journals, and publications in English can improve vocabulary and understanding abilities.
4. Join Preparation Classes
Getting involved in IELTS preparation classes offers directed guideline and valuable tips from experienced instructors. Numerous language schools in Uzbekistan deal focused courses for IELTS.
5. Practice Time Management
Replicate testing conditions by timing your practice tests. This will assist in managing time successfully during the real exam. Keep in mind, each section has a strict time frame.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What is the passing rating for IELTS in Uzbekistan?
The passing score differs depending upon the organization or organization you are using to. Typically, a rating of 6.0 to 7.0 is thought about competitive for universities in English-speaking nations.
2. Can I retake the IELTS exam if I am not satisfied with my rating?
Yes, prospects can retake the IELTS exam as lot of times as required. It is suggested to review your performance before the retake to recognize locations for enhancement.
3. Are there any regional tutoring centers in Uzbekistan that focus on IELTS preparation?
Yes, several language centers in Uzbekistan offer IELTS preparation courses. It is recommended to inspect reviews and suggestions to discover the very best suitable for your learning style.
4. The length of time does it require to prepare for the IELTS exam?
The preparation time varies per individual. Normally, devoted study over a period of 6-8 weeks is adequate for most prospects.
5. Is it possible to prepare for the IELTS independently?
Definitely! Lots of candidates effectively prepare for the IELTS by themselves by utilizing books, online resources, and practice tests.
